KICKARTS Resonance - A natural frequency, a
vibration determined by the physical
experience of living on country. This work
is a visual response to country, to the land
that has formed and nurtured these three
proud women of Yarrabah – Edna Ambrym,
Philomena Yeatman and Valmai Pollard.
Resonance is a collaboration between
Yarrabah Art Centre and projection
specialists AGB Events.

The Making Place - Make new friends, make
new things and make new experiences
at The Making Place. This is a FREE
workshop and performance space that will
feature a range of local artists, performers
and community and cultural organisations.
This smorgasbord of workshops includes
still life drawing, Pastel finger art and
don’t miss photographer Peter Solness at
his pop-up studio where he will be creating
family portraits with a difference.
